Hey, it's Kim (she/her).


For over 15 years Kim has been photographing families, first responders and international & local equestrian events. In 2004 she graduated with a Bachelors degree in Fine Art and continues to practise the art of photography as a passion and creative outlet. She loves capturing natural and candid lifestyle images that really bring out each individual's personality. No two scenes are the same as we never provide preset backgrounds or props. Our photos are as unique as you are.


As she is married to a first responder, she is extremely passionate about first responder mental health and offers 911 discounts to families and individuals who are active (including volunteer) or retired in Police, Fire, EMS and Military. This is a way to thank those who give so much each day, both the individual and their families, for their service and sacrifices.


Kim has been involved with the equestrian industry her entire life and is passionate about capturing equine images that you will be proud to share. For 40 years she has been an Arabian horse enthusiast as an amateur competitor and daughter of a retired professional trainer and "R" rated judge. She has shown all over North America including Canadian Nationals, Ohio Buckeye and the Egyptian Event in Lexington Kentucky obtaining many Championships over the years. Personally being involved in the horse industry gives her the cutting edge on what the market is seeking and the ability to capture images for you to utilize for personal or marketing use. She has worked with stallions, foals and senior horses along with professional trainers and new riders all over Ontario and WNY.


Her quiet demeanour and experience working with children and adults with differing abilities makes her a popular choice for families. Sessions are private and quiet which is a perfect for those who may be over stimulated by light, sound and action. Kim has extensive experience working with neuro-diverse children and is experienced in offering sessions to suit all needs and abilities.
